One simple trick to cut down on the number of missed appointments … low price branded shirtsWebStep 1: Make Sure You're Eligible. To be eligible for the NASM Personal Trainer Certification Exam, here are the personal trainer education requirements: Have a high school degree or GED. Hold a current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ation (CPR) certification. Hold an Automated External Defibrillator (AED) certification. low price bucket truck
